Eight departments of the State Council launch inspections of high-energy-consumption and high-pollution industries.
On June 19, news reported that eight inspection teams—composed of eight departments including the National Development and Reform Commission—will successively head to several provinces to conduct focused investigations into the elimination of preferential policies—including electricity prices, land prices, and tax and fee reductions—that have been improperly introduced for high-energy-consuming and high-polluting industries. The primary focus of these inspections will be on other high-energy-consuming and high-polluting industries with strong regional characteristics, such as steel, copper, aluminum, lead-zinc, cement, power generation, calcium carbide, coke, and ferroalloys.

The second transmission and transformation project of the State Grid’s westward expansion into Qaidam has been put into operation.
At 15:36 on August 23, 2007, Xu Fushun, Vice Governor of Qinghai Province, issued the start-up command. Following established procedures, dispatchers ordered the 330 kV Mingzhu Substation to begin power transmission. The Xijin Chaidamu II Transmission and Transformation Project in Qinghai Province includes the construction of two new 330 kV substations—Mingzhu and Bayin—as well as a 772-kilometer transmission line at 330 kV running from Huangyuan to Mingzhu, then to Ulan, Bayin River, and finally to Golmud. Additionally, the project involves the expansion of three existing 330 kV substations—Golmud, Huangyuan, and Ulan—and the installation of five main transformers with a total capacity of 390 MVA. This project represents the largest and most challenging undertaking in the history of Qinghai’s power grid development. Once put into operation, the project will further enhance Qinghai’s main power supply.
The 5th Shanghai International Power Plant Equipment and Flue Gas Desulfurization & Denitrification Exhibition, 2009
The “ChinaEpower Shanghai International Power Plant Equipment and Flue Gas Desulfurization & Denitrification Exhibition” is China’s largest, most attended, and internationally influential environmental protection event for power plants. Each edition of the exhibition comprehensively showcases products, technologies, and solutions from around the world, reflecting a highly influential market leadership position. It has been successfully held in Shanghai for four consecutive sessions. To date, it has attracted over 1,200 exhibitors from more than 20 countries and regions. The “ChinaEPower 2009—5th Shanghai International Power Plant Equipment and Flue Gas Desulfurization & Denitrification Exhibition” will continue to be held from April 23 to 25, 2009, at the Shanghai International Exhibition Center. In line with the nation’s efforts to promote the industrial development of flue gas desulfurization, ChinaEPower 2009 will uphold its consistent high-quality standards and successful approach, showcasing new and advanced products, cutting-edge technologies, environmental protection concepts, manufacturing models, and management methods from top global manufacturers and suppliers. A Review of the 2008 Exhibition: The “ChinaEPower 2008—4th Shanghai International Power Plant Equipment and Flue Gas Desulfurization & Denitrification Exhibition” was successfully held from April 22 to 24, 2008, at the Shanghai International Exhibition Center. This domestically significant and influential exhibition in the power plant environmental protection industry concluded to widespread acclaim from exhibitors, visitors, and industry professionals both at home and abroad. Numerous authoritative media outlets at home and abroad—including CCTV-4, Xinhua News Agency, Liberation Daily, Evening News, First Finance Daily, the U.S.-based International Daily, Wenhui Daily, Dragon TV, China Environmental News, China Daily, China Business News, Yangtze Evening News, China-Foreign Exhibition News, China-US Post, People’s Daily, SMG Shangshi (News Comprehensive), News Morning Post, Times Weekly, Xinhuanet, argusasiagas&power, industrialautomationasia, industrialfuelsandpowermagazine, projectfinanceinternational, and major industry websites and magazines—reported on this year’s exhibition. This year’s exhibition brought together 302 international and domestic brand enterprises, including SIEMENS, GE, ALSTOM, TOSHIBA, HITACHI, IDRECO, ARGILLON, Denmark’s Topsoe, Bock-Durr, Diamond, Hanwha Industrial, Dow Chemical, Shanghai Electric, Fujian Longjing, Guodian Longyuan, and CITIC Power Yuanda. Exhibitors came from 18 countries and regions, and the exhibition area exceeded 10,000 square meters. The event attracted 12,128 professional visitors from over 20 countries and regions, with overseas visitors accounting for 16%. This marked a new historical high in terms of the number of exhibiting companies, visitor attendance, and exhibition area since the inception of the show. The successful holding of ChinaEPower 2008 played a positive role in introducing advanced foreign technologies and equipment, promoting technical cooperation and exchanges between Chinese and foreign enterprises, and facilitating the exchange of market information.
